What happens to your document
- 1. Browser inputYour browser reads the file you select. Document bytes are not sent to a LocalPDF processing API.
- 2. Local resultThe tool performs the operation in this tab and creates its result in browser memory.
- 3. Your downloadYou choose whether to download the result. Browser memory is cleared when the page is closed or reloaded.
Why Process PDFs Locally?
Supported workflows process document bytes in the browser without a document-byte upload to LocalPDF. Device, browser, extension, download, storage, and later-sharing risks remain separate boundaries.
